1. The Allure of Moroccan Cities
1.1 Marrakech: The Red City
Marrakech is perhaps Morocco’s most famous city, known for its vibrant souks (markets), stunning palaces, and gardens. Here are some must-visit spots:
- Jemaa el-Fnaa: An iconic square that transforms during the day from a marketplace to a lively scene filled with street performers by night. Koutoubia Mosque: This majestic mosque is a symbol of Marrakech; its minaret can be seen from miles away. Majorelle Garden: A serene oasis filled with exotic plants and bright blue buildings.
1.2 Fes: The Cultural Capital
Fes is often hailed as the cultural heart of Morocco. Its ancient medina is a UNESCO World Heritage site filled with history.
- Bou Inania Madrasa: A beautiful example of Marinid architecture. Tannery Quarter: Experience the traditional leather-making process firsthand.
1.3 Chefchaouen: The Blue Pearl
Renowned for its blue-painted streets, Chefchaouen provides a tranquil escape.
- Ras El Maa Waterfall: Perfect for those looking to enjoy nature right at their doorstep.
2. Culinary Delights in Morocco
Moroccan cuisine is as diverse as its landscape. From tagines to couscous, here's what you should try:
2.1 Traditional Dishes
- Tagine: Slow-cooked savory stews made in conical clay pots. Couscous: Often served on Fridays, this dish is made from steamed semolina.
2.2 Street Food Adventures
Street food in Morocco offers exciting flavors:
- Sfenj: Moroccan doughnuts that are crispy on the outside and soft within.

4. Cultural Insights
Understanding Moroccan culture enhances your travel experience:
4.1 Festivals and Events
Participate in local festivals like:
- Marrakech Popular Arts Festival: A celebration of music and arts showcasing local talent.
4.2 Local Etiquette
Respecting local customs can go a long way:
- Dress modestly when visiting religious sites.

FAQs
1. What is the best time to visit Morocco?
The best times to visit are spring (March-May) and fall (September-November) when temperatures are pleasant for sightseeing.
2. Do I need a visa to enter Morocco?
U.S citizens do not require a visa for stays under 90 days; however, it's essential to have a valid passport.
3. Is it safe to travel alone in Morocco?
Generally speaking, yes! However, it's advisable to stay aware of your surroundings just as you would anywhere else.
4. What currency is used in Morocco?
The official currency is the Moroccan Dirham (MAD).
